LLC Lookup in Wyoming

Wyoming has gained considerable attention as a friendly state for forming LLCs due to its business-friendly regulations and financial benefits. When looking for an Limited Liability Company in Wyoming, it is important to utilize the state’s SoS website, where persons can conduct a comprehensive company search. This tool allows users to find information on business entities registered in Wyoming, including current and inactive limited liability companies, by entering the company name or the agent's details.

One key benefit of establishing an LLC in Wyoming is the state’s focus to maintaining business confidentiality. Wyoming does not require the revelation of owner names in public filings, making it an attractive option for entrepreneurs seeking discretion.  LLC public records  provides ownership but also enables potential business owners to verify the existence and status of an Limited Liability Company, ensuring they make informed decisions when entering partnerships or investments.

LLC Search in the Lone Star State

In the Lone Star State, the process of conducting an Limited Liability Company search is crucial for business founders and business owners looking to set up a business entity. The Secretary of State of Texas maintains a detailed database that allows users to search for registered businesses, including limited liability companies. This search can be conducted via the internet, providing fast access to vital information such as the business's standing, establishment date, and registered agents. Knowing how to navigate this lookup is essential for anyone considering launching a business in the region.

When performing an LLC search in Texas, users can enter various parameters to narrow down their results. This includes looking by the title of the LLC, the filing number, or the name of the designated agent. The outcomes can help individuals confirm that their desired business name is available and not already in operation by another business. Additionally, verifying the standing of existing limited liability companies is essential for potential partners or investors who wish to verify the validity of a company.
